**Early Childhood Educator (Certificate III) - Multiple roles available at Moomba Park Early Learning Victoria centre**

Early Learning Victoria is establishing a government-owned early learning and childcare centre at Moomba Park Primary School in Fawkner. Opening in 2025, this 130-place centre will offer childcare, and Three and Four-Year-Old Kindergarten, eventually transitioning to include Pre-Prep. The centre will also be co-located with maternal and child health services and other family services.

**Role Purpose**:
The Early Childhood Educator (cert III) will support the team to deliver high-quality early childhood education, guided by evidence-informed, contemporary pedagogy and practice, which is aligned with the National Quality Standards, Victorian Early Years Learning and Development Framework and National Education and Care Law and Regulations. They will be responsible for contributing and assisting in the planning and implementing the educational program, monitoring children's progress, and supporting their social, emotional, and cognitive development.
